1. Start your revision by taking one mock test daily from the online test series of LIC AAO exam.

2. Analyze your weaknesses and try to improve them. Revise the relevant topic from the best resource books o exam material that you have procured for the exam preparation. Revise from the same source to revive the concepts again in case you have not understood then.

3. For doubt sessions you can seek the help from the subject experts available at the online portals. Join any of the reputed online test series for LIC AAO exam where they provide feedback of your performance followed by the doubt sessions.

4. Make a list of the mathematics formulae which are repeatedly used in various questions. Revision will enable you to retain them for a long and you will be able to practice them constructively.

5.Take speed tests of the comprehensive topics of every subject from the test series package. Monitor the time taken by you to solve the set of questions given in the speed tests. Improve speed and accuracy simultaneously which is only possible by revising and practicing the topics subsequently.

6. Keep a track of your performance tally of mock tests and compare it with the last year cut-off marks of LIC AAO EXAM. Set your target to meet the expected cut-off limit of the forthcoming exam which will be more than the previous one. Try to improve your score in every attempt after the analysis.

7. In case you are not able to coupe up with your previous exam preparation, may be you did self study, then you can join online video course for LIC AAO EXAM and listen to the video lectures of almost all the subjects to give a quick and easy revision of the topics which needs more learning and understanding.

8. In the mains there is general awareness section where current affairs based questions are asked from financial and insurance sector. Revise them daily from the notes which you have prepared during your exam preparation. It is the integral part of your exam as you are expected to be professionally aware of the sector in which you are pursuing the job.
